The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) has released proposed and final rules that will regulate methane emissions from oil and gas operations, implement a methane emissions tax, and change greenhouse gas reporting requirements. These changes will impact the upstream, midstream, and transmission sectors. This program will highlight what you need to know about how these new rules intersect, new compliance and enforcement risks, and how to plan now for operations and upcoming transactions.
